Club members enjoyed fishing at Rainbow Beach recently, during which time there were good catches of dart to 41cm as well as a few nice-sized bream. Others also fished at Kauri Creek where some caught whiting and flathead, but generally the fishing was slow.
Squid are being caught throughout the Bay and there are good numbers of Sand Crabs appearing as well. Diver whiting are being caught in reasonable numbers but you have to move around and locate them.
Large numbers of small to just legal bream have been seen in the shallows and the recommended baits are strips of mullet or yabbies.
